When you questioned Dr. Ismail, he'd tell you that his theory is accurate. But his effects have not been printed in the peer-reviewed health-related journal. And users from the professional medical Local community — such as the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) — don't endorse this method.

The Ramzi theory is often a method of predicting the gender of the unborn baby applying ultrasound scans. It absolutely was developed in 2004 by Dr Saad Ramzi Ismail and is based on the location of placental tissue for the duration of 6-7 days ultrasound scans.
